initializing a 3 dimension array

Hey everybody.

Ive created a 3 dimension integer array, it's go like this:
List<List<List<integer>>> ArrayList = new  List<List<List<integer>>>();

the thing is that i'm trying to approach cell directly, like that:
ArrayList[2][3][4] = 7;

and im getting:
FATAL_ERROR|System.ListException: List index out of bounds: 2

which i was guessing is because i havnt initialized the cell and tried to approach it directly.

ive run a 3 nested for loops in order to initialize the array using:
ArrayList.add(0);
but i kept getting the same message (this time: List index out of bounds: 0, of course)

so im a bit stuck and dont know how to deal with this array but im surely have to use it

suggestions will be welcomed!

Just got it. This is how you initalize a 3 dimension array:

public void test(){
        integer d1_size = 5;
        integer d2_size = 20;
        integer d3_size = 4;
       
        list<list<list<integer>>> three_d_array = new list<list<list<integer>>>();
        list<list<integer>> two_d_array = new list<list<integer>>();
        list<integer> one_d_array = new list<integer>();
       
        for(integer i=0 ; i<d3_size ; i++){
            for(integer j=0 ; j<d2_size ; j++){
                for(integer k=0 ; k<d1_size ;k++){
                    one_d_array.add(0);
                }
                two_d_array.add(one_d_array);
            }
            three_d_array.add(two_d_array);
        }               
 }

You have to put a value in the array first in order to be able to get something from a position. It seems that you only added one element arrayList.add(0) and trying to access third element ArrayList [2].
